Emilia (2005) is a quiet exploration of social responsibility and personal connection. The film weaves through the emotional landscape of Emilia Seiler's journey to her hometown, where she celebrates the tenth anniversary of a youth home that reflects her ideals. The pacing is contemplative, allowing us to soak in the weight of the past and the hope for the future. The atmosphere is tinged with a sense of nostalgia and the struggles that accompany change. While the performances are understated, they convey a deep sense of authenticity, drawing the viewer into Emilia's world and her mission. It’s the little moments and dialogues that resonate, painting a vivid picture of dedication to a cause, which makes it quite distinctive in the realm of drama.
